Output e3f23184c18ce0a7f8c224a906e2a7b7cb7763ef467d7496550fae3c661b69b9:10

value
1013031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cc3840f2d0ed4390b5f4183a22b180ce99044eb OP_EQUAL
address
3QjWRZiYLdmCHjf3hy7wrtv2pAu1MvDufv
transaction
e3f23184c18ce0a7f8c224a906e2a7b7cb7763ef467d7496550fae3c661b69b9
spent
true